Transaction 16a2ba96954782d4b750d3bd90d80f78ba101b9cc16c0d6b0c7653504e27a7e7

1 Input
2 Outputs
  • 16a2ba96954782d4b750d3bd90d80f78ba101b9cc16c0d6b0c7653504e27a7e7:0
  • value  49431556183
    address  2NDDuEvjTMHx1pGxhTZMFJPojMwhhHzNfs4
  • 16a2ba96954782d4b750d3bd90d80f78ba101b9cc16c0d6b0c7653504e27a7e7:1
  • value  70000
    address  mw7CC2mqszxoKam5WcHXmmRVbH9GzV8XFx